Pilot Travel Center Tucson sits just off I-10 on the north side of the metro, serving drivers running the Southern Tier corridor between Phoenix and El Paso. Open around the clock, this location offers diesel fuel, truck parking, and the basics owner-operators and fleet drivers expect from the Pilot Flying J network. With over 3,500 Google reviews and a 4.2-star rating, it's a proven stop for commercial traffic moving freight across southern Arizona. The plaza caters to long-haul teams needing a quick fuel-and-go as well as drivers looking to grab a few hours of rest before pushing east into New Mexico or west toward the California state line. Whether you're hauling produce out of Nogales or running intermodal from the Tucson rail yards, this Pilot gives you a reliable northside option before the desert stretches thin.
